<h3>Tips for Cyclist Safety</h3>
Cyclists are urged to take extra precautions when navigating busy intersections, including:
- Wearing high-visibility clothing: Bright clothing and reflective gear significantly increase visibility to drivers.
- Using lights: Front and rear lights, especially at dawn and dusk, are crucial for safety.
- Following traffic laws: Obeying traffic signals and signs is essential for preventing accidents.
- Maintaining a safe distance from vehicles: Give vehicles plenty of space to avoid potential collisions.
- Riding predictably: Signal your intentions clearly to drivers.
